The spider’s thread

Do you not know that to whom you present yourselves slaves to obey, you are that one's slaves whom you obey.

If the Son makes you free, you shall be free indeed.

Romans 6: 16; John 8: 36.

The spider's thread
My work forced me to live away from home for long periods. That was a burden for my family. My young daughter once decided to tie me hand and foot to stop me from going away. Armed with a ball of string, she started to wind it round me. After a few circuits she stopped and said triumphantly: "Daddy, try to get free!" I could easily have broken free, but didn't want to spoil her fun. She again skipped round me with the ball in her hand. "Can you get out?" I pretended to try and failed, which pleased her. She bound me up completely, and I attempted to break the bonds. It was too late. What would have been child's play at the start was now impossible. "There! You're a prisoner!" she cried jubilantly, clapping her hands. Whether I liked it or not, I had to call my wife for help.

This incident reminded me of the spider's technique. To neutralise its prey, it entwines it in a very fine, but very strong thread, long enough to totally paralyse it.

The devil uses the same technique, enticing his prey little by little into habits from which it cannot extricate itself, so that it falls into some fatal addiction. However, it is never too late to call on God to be freed completely. .

Today‘s reading: 1 Kings 19: 1 - 10 · John 12: 27 - 36
